Tulsans have the worst teeth

So sayeth a press release I JUST opened via email.
Tulsa ranks No. 4 on the 10 Worst-Teeth Cities in the Country list, according to rankings by TotalBeauty.com.
Factors considered in these rankings when it came to having decent pearly whites include regular dentist visits; not smoking; minimizing coffee, tea, soda and red wine intake; and, tops on a dentist's list, brushing and flossing. Living in an area with hard water or a dry climate, which can stain teeth and create dry mouth, could also contribute to bad teeth.
Here is TotalBeauty.com's list of The 10 Worst-Teeth Cities in the country:
10. Las Vegas, Nevada
9. Atlanta, Georgia
8. Houston, Texas
7. Greensboro, North Carolina
6. Bristol, Tennessee
5. Baton Rouge, Louisiana
4. Tulsa, Oklahoma
3. Mobile, Alabama
2. Huntington, West Virginia
1. Biloxi, Mississippi
Just food for thought, y'all.

Living Wright
While other kids were watching "The Smurfs," Scene Writer Jason Ashley Wright was tuned in to "Style with Elsa Klensch." By fourth grade, he knew he wanted to write, and spent almost three years publishing a weekly teen-oriented magazine, Teen-Zine -- circulation: 2. After earning a degree in journalism from the University of Southern Mississippi, he became the medical reporter and teen board coordinator for the Hattiesburg (Miss.) American, a Gannett newspaper. Eight months later, with visions of Elsa dancing in his head, he applied for the fashion writer position at the Tulsa World, where he began working on Aug. 3, 1998. He is now a general assignment reporter for Scene.
